The General Barton & Stovall History/Heritage Association concluded its annual meeting over the past weekend at a location associated with the Georgia Brigade-this year it was Morristown, Tennessee and the Knoxville, Tazewell, Cumberland Gap area. The Georgia 40th, 41st, 42nd, 43rd, and 52nd infantry regiments along with other units did a passel of marching and covering the various mountain gaps in Northeast Tennessee in 1862 in pursuit of the Yankee.
